8.1 mile Ka 34.7 with the Redline
I was on the 40 this week heading to the Colorado River on the Nevada/Arizona border and got an 8.1 mile Ka 34.7 alert ... my longest so far. It was even more impressive considering the cop was moving towards me the whole time. So figuring 70 mph each, that was about a million miles on the range (don't feel like doing the math but it was good). The Redline dropped the alert a couple of times, but that was due to terrain I suspect (mountains). I was very impressed, and it gave me something to do on a boring drive.
Overall, in nearly 600 miles round trip I got about five CHP hits ... however, once I got to Nevada/Arizona my Redline went crazy, I could not get in my car for even a five minute drive without getting at least one 35.5 or 33.8 hit. Hell, within 30 minutes of crossing into Nevada I got four Ka hits, LOL. Talk about speed trap heaven ... I feel bad for speeders who live in such places. It was the suck.

In summer Nevada Highway Patrol is all 'out there' in the boonies and in larger numbers. After Labor Day, they will pretty much stick to nearby towns, for the duration until Memorial Day (with exceptions for Thanksgiving, Christmas/New Years).
